PHP HTML dizeleri yazmak için daha iyi bir yolu var mı?

0 Cevap php

Kendimi HTML kodunu döndürür PHP fonksiyonları bir sürü yazı bulabilirsiniz. Onlar böyle bir şey olabilir:

function html_site_head()
{
    return
        "
            <div id=\"site_header\">
                <div id=\"site_header_inner\">
                    <div id=\"site_header_logo\"></div>

                    <div id=\"site_header_countdown\">BARE XX DAGER IGJEN</div>
                </div>
            </div>
        ";
}

Şimdi ben PHP uzun dizeler yazmak için daha iyi yollar gördüm yemin edebilirim. Bunu yapmanın python yolunu seviyorum:

return """
    <div id="site_header">
        <div id="site_header_inner">
            <div id="site_header_logo"></div>

            <div id="site_header_countdown">BARE XX DAGER IGJEN</div>
        </div>
    </div>
"""

Eğer tırnak işaretleri kaçmak yok gibi. Alternatif tek tırnak işaretleri kullanarak, ama bu hiçbir dize doğrudan PHP değişkenleri kullanarak anlamına gelir. Ben PHP böyle bir şey gördüm yemin:

return <<<
    <div id="site_header">
        <div id="site_header_inner">
            <div id="site_header_logo"></div>

            <div id="site_header_countdown">BARE XX DAGER IGJEN</div>
        </div>
    </div>

Ya da benzer bir şey. Birisi bu benim hafızamı tazelemek misiniz?

Teşekkürler

0 Cevap